Web11 mrt. 2012 · The nurse uses teach-back to assess Mr. Bank’s learning process by asking him to repeat the information he’s heard in his own words. This enhances his learning by helping him understand his condition and how to control his blood sugar with medications. WebA teaching plan follows the steps of the nursing process. (1) Develop measurable learner objectives for each diagnosis of a learning need. (a) Identify short-term and long-term objectives. (b) Prioritize the objectives. Web24 dec. 2016 · Demonstration and Laboratory Method of Teaching in Nursing The demonstration method teaches by exhibition and explanation. Although it is sometimes used to refer all illustrative teaching, the term demonstration usually is taken to mean explanation of a process, as opposed to exemplification of the object itself.
